>>> My concern here would be that distributions may still be shipping
>> isl-0.14.
>>> Fedora 25 (for example) still uses iso-0.14.
>>
>> isl isn't a mandatory requirement for building gcc, worst case you just
>> don't have graphite support.  Fedora 26 already has isl-0.16.1.
> 
> Yeah.  Note that even with ISL 0.15 there are known bugs.  I just hope that w/o the legacy code maintainance would be easier.

And there are at least 2 bugs (PR79471 and PR69675) which ICE with ISL 0.16 and are fixed (well no transformation is done)
in 0.18. But maybe it just hide the ICE instead of not introducing PHI nodes usage before a definition.
